  3. The guy in charge of the car washing business was there today when I went to the Hamlet. The gate was locked shut with a private security guard and car there, with a dog. Car wash guy wasn't too clear when I asked him what had happened but clearly quite upset as his business is just stopped - he seemed to imply the new owner(?) doesn't want his business operating there in the car park. Seems a shame if so - I went there a lot and it always seemed popular. I stand to be corrected if anyone knows anything more.

  24. To me 4 seems really unlikely. The entire world plane fleet isn't replaced overnight so unless we can tie a major change of fleet to November 2012, the date reports are that the noise complaints increased significantly, then that can only be a minor factor at best. 3, agreed, very unlikely. So that leaves one and two and a significant increase in complaints since November 2012, which leaves me asking what happened then?
